Where do people buy those peanut shaped balancing objects used to help condition their sport dogs? Any recommendations? Are some shapes/brands better than others?

I'd rather buy one in person rather than pay for shipping, but I'm not sure if there's a place in the Toronto area that sells them.

I'm totally clueless and haven't looked into buying one before, but I'd like to start using one with Cohen. Any help is greatly appreciated!

E: I wanted to add I'm more interested in using the item for strength training than body-awareness. Does that make a difference?

We've used the fit paws, jelly discs, and regular human balance balls but my instructors both use peanut balls for their bigger dogs. Check out fitness stores in the pilates/core section.
